按年龄范围查找

首先是下拉菜单:
<option value="0-9">0-9岁</option>
<option value="10-19">10-19岁</option>
<option value="20-29">20-29岁</option>
<option value="30-39">30-39岁</option>
<option value="40-49">40-49岁</option>
<option value="50-59">50-59岁</option>
<option value="60-69">60-69岁</option>
<option value="70-79">70-79岁</option>
<option value="80-89">80-89岁</option>
<option value="90-100">90-100岁</option>                
</select></td>

在下拉菜单点击后,利用:
$_GET["birthday"]=$HTTP_POST_VARS["birthday"];
取得值“0-9”等字段。
利用下面的代码实现分离“birthday”的值‘0’和‘9’。
对日期进行处理(前面已经定义:$today = date("Y-m-d");)

     $birthday=explode('-',$_GET["birthday"]);
     //die($birthday[0]);
     $date= explode('-',$today);
    $year1=$date[0]-$birthday[0];
    $year2=$date[0]-$birthday[1];
    $date1=$year1."-".$date[1]."-".$date[2];
    $date2=$year2."-".$date[1]."-".$date[2];
    //die($date1." - ".$date2);
    if($str_sql!="")
    $str_sql=$str_sql . " and ";
    $str_sql=$str_sql . "birthday>'" . $date2 . "' and birthday<'".$date1 . "'";
 
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值